Message-Id: <201204051758.48305.b_mann () gmx ! de> X-MARC-Message: https://marc.info/?l=kde-games-devel&m=133364163108395 On Thursday 05 April 2012, Zsur=F3 Tibor wrote: > Hello Hi > I want use the 'bool connectToServer( QString, int )' function in > KGame(KGameNetwork) class, to connect to server. If the server is not run > or the ip address is incorrect, always return true. > = > In the API: "Returns: true if connected". > = > This is bug? > = > I want show error messagge, when the connection is fail. Looking at the code, I'd say it's a lack of documentation. A comment in the = code: // OK: We say that we already have connected, but this isn't so yet! // If the connection cannot be established, it will look as being = disconnected // again ("slotConnectionLost" is called). // Shall we differ between these? So it seems to me that the code merely returns true here if the connection = was = initiated (not established) successfully and once the host not reachable (o= r = whatever) message is received, the connection is considered "lost". So KGameNetwork should emit the signalConnectionBroken() signal then. btw: The KGame library of libkdegames is unmaintained these days, I recomme= nd = against using it in new games.
